## Deploying the Gatewick Proctor Queue

Deploys are pretty painless: push to main, wait for the pipeline, then watch the queue drain dashboard for five minutes. If candidates pile up mid-exam, roll back first and ask questions later — the queue replays safely. Everything the workers care about lives in one config block, shown here for reference.

settings of bafof-yagef:
JOROX_PIN=8740
JOROX_TENANT=pelox
JOROX_METRICS_HOST=metrics.jorox.qorvelworks.internal
JOROX_SEAL=seal_c78f63c1
JOROX_STANDBY_TEAM=norax

## Changelog — GridLoad CSV Import Wizard v2.9.1

Mostly housekeeping this round. Fixed the delimiter sniffer choking on semicolon files, and the preview table now shows the first 50 rows instead of 20. Biggest change: we rotated the release signing key after the old one hit its expiry. If you're packaging builds for the Tornquist deployment, update your verification config. The new signing key is below.

deploy key for kajof-fajop: bky6_gDHw9Q

The renewal of our three-year agreement with Torvane Materials has been assessed in detail. Proposed terms include a 4.2% unit-price increase, partially offset by improved volume rebates and extended payment terms of sixty days. Sensitivity analysis indicates a net annual cost impact of under 1% on the Meridia product line, assuming stable demand. Legal has flagged no material changes to liability clauses. We recommend approval, subject to the conditions outlined in the confidential note below.

confidential, yawip-bahif: Zorokox Partners plans to lower the Casax list price by 28.0 percent in April. The board signed off on a budget of $271.0 million for Project Juldor. The renewal with Pelokox Partners closes at $410.1 million a year, 3.4 percent below the last contract. Project Pelok slips by a full year because of the audit delay.

Step 5 — Pushing the AgriLink gateway build

Quick heads-up for review: the telemetry gateway firmware won't flash unless the image is signed, which is by design — field units on the Harrowmere test farm reject unsigned payloads outright. Double-check that the signer config matches what's in the hardening doc, and flag anything that looks off. Once you're satisfied, the build box should be provisioned with the deploy key below.

release key, hadug-kawef: bky13_mPGeFZeR1GZ1G